#19f8d1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#19f8d1 is composed of 9.8% red, 97.3%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.7%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 169.5 degrees, a saturation of 94.1% and a lightness of 53.5%. #19f8d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#32ffff with #00f1a3.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#19f8d1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01110f is the darkest color, while #fdff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#19f8d1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868b8a is the less saturated color, while #19f8d1 is the most saturated one.
